WebFeb 23, 2024 · Camera Specifics. The Kodak Instamatic 133 was manufactured from 1968. It was designed by Alexander Gow with styling by Sir Kenneth Grange who is also the designer for the Kodak Vecta, Brownie 44A and 44B, and the Instamatic 25.
